Yes, but that phone is a Samsung Behold II Phone MADE to run it.  Different chipset, different phone.  Our Samsung Phones (Eternity, Impression, Solstice) are sadly not made to run Android.  Attempting to install that method will most probably brick (kill) it with the method provided.  If you want an Android phone and have AT&T you might want to look into getting a Motorola Backflip.

you can buy the AT&T band version of the Nexus One, or buy any T-Mobile phone and unlock it (If you unlock a T-Mobile phone, u won't get 3G on at&t).  Verizon and Sprint use a totally different band (CDMA, not GSM like AT&T and T-Mobile), so u cannot just unlock those phones and pop in your SIM (CDMA isn't made to use SIMs)
